Warning Signs You Need High-Velocity Air Mover Drying
Catching the warning signs of water damage early can save you time, money, and stress in the long run.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it may be a sign of hidden water dam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ore this warning sign,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age or poor drainage.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of structural problems.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
Discolored or Fading Drywall
Discolored or fading drywall can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
Increased Humidity or Mold Growth
Increased humidity or mold growth can be a sign of water damage or poor ventilation.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.
Water Stains or Mineral Deposits
Water stains or mineral deposits can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
High-Velocity Air Mover Drying v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ill in a contained area | Yes | No | DIY can be effective for small spills, but be sure to act quickly and follow proper drying procedures. |
| Large water damage or flooding |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are necessary to ensure safe and effective drying and restoration. |
| Hidden water damage or mold growth | No | Yes | Hidden water damage or mold growth need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and address. |
| High-velocity air mover rental or buy | No | Yes | Professionals have access to the latest equipment and can ensure proper setup and operation. |
| Water damage in a sensitive or historic area | No | Yes | Professional restorers have the training and expertise to handle sensitive or historic areas with care. |
| Water damage in a commercial or industrial setting | No | Yes | Commercial or industrial water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to ensure safe and effective drying and restoration. |
While DIY can be effective for small spills, it’s essential to call a professional for larger water damage, hidden water damage, or sensitive areas. Our team has the expertise and equipment to ensure safe and effective drying and restoration, reducing the risk of further damage and health risks.

Common Questions About High-Velocity Air Mover Drying
Q: What is high-velocity air mover drying?
A: High-velocity air mover drying is a specialized restoration service that uses high-speed fans and d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from a property, reducing the risk of further damage and health risks. Our team uses this equipment to dry properties quickly and efficiently, reducing the risk of mold growth and structural problems.
Q: How long does high-velocity air mover drying take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ete high-velocity air mover drying dep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. On average, our team can complete the process within 3-5 days, but this may vary depending on your specific situation.
